About the project and the position

A consortium of six organizations, including Médecins du Monde (MdM), Skoun, Abaad, Amel, Embrace and Humanity and Inclusion (HI), along with National Mental Health Program (NMHP), supported by the Agence Francaise de Development (AFD), aims to improve the opportunities for individuals living in Lebanon to enjoy the best possible mental health and wellbeing. The consortium is looking to recruit a mental health expert to develop and review training modules on different topics such as PFA, ECM, mhGAP, PM+, parenting skills, self-care etc.
